This leadership role within the UnitedHealth Group (UHG) Environmental, Occupational Health & Safety (EOHS) organization serves as the enterprise authority for workplace safety and environmental compliance. The Associate Director leads the environmental health and safety team within EOHS Technical Services, providing strategic direction, technical expertise, and governance for the development and deployment of enterprise-wide tools, systems, policies, training, and processes that enable effective implementation of global safety and environmental compliance requirements across UHG operations.
Reporting directly to the Sr. Director of Global EOHS Technical Services, the Associate Director is a key member of the EOHS leadership team and acts as UHG's subject matter expert in environmental health and safety regulatory frameworks, exposure science, and environmental risk management. This role is responsible for designing and deploying the systems, standards, and enterprise programs that enable consistent environmental stewardship and protection of worker safety and health.

Primary Responsibilities:
  • Environmental, Health and Safety Leadership
    • Provide expert technical direction for all enterprise workplace safety and environmental compliance programs
    • Lead the enterprise industrial hygiene strategy, including exposure assessment, monitoring protocols, sampling strategies (air, water, surface, noise), and control methodologies
    • Establish governance for indoor environmental quality across office, operational, and high-risk environments
    • Oversee development and maintenance of hazardous and regulated waste programs
  • Program Strategy, Governance & Systems:
    • Develop and execute the enterprise workplace safety, environmental and industrial hygiene strategy
    • Leverage data analytics and technology to enhance EHS visibility and develop tools to proactively reduce operational EHS risk
    • Lead creation and maintenance of policies, standards, and technical guidance
  • Risk Management & Regulatory Responsibilities:
    • Direct workplace safety, environmental and industrial hygiene risk assessments and compliance evaluations
    • Manage regulatory relationships and ensure timely submission of required reports, permits, and notifications
    • Maintain expert-level knowledge of applicable workplace safety, environmental and occupational health regulations
  • Leadership, Collaboration & Stakeholder Engagement:
    • Lead and develop a high-performing team of environmental, health and safety professionals
    • Oversee third-party consultants and vendors
    • Collaborate with internal partners across the enterprise
    • Develop and report enterprise environmental health and safety metrics as applicable
  • Manage budgets, resource planning, and long-range capability development
  • Perform other duties as assigned

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
